History
In early 2004, Margaret Thomas approached the Justice, Peace, and Environment Committee at Village Presbyterian Church to ask for their participation in the Shawnee Mission East Earth Fair in April of that year. Jerry Rees, Chuck Gillam, Jennifer Byer, and Christine Caseres collaborated on the event and decided to continue meeting afterward using the name SMEEFF (Shawnee Mission East Earth Fair Folk).
After some months of meeting, the group renamed itself the Sustainable Sanctuary Coalition and became incorporated as a 501C(3) non-profit organization. The Board of Directors consisted of: Terry Wiggins, Jerry Rees, Christine Caseres, and Margaret Thomas. The mission of the group was to promote earth care among faith communities.
The group has continued to meet monthly through the years and carry out its activities. The membership has grown significantly and includes some 25 to 30 individuals from Kansas City area congregations. Although most of the participation is from Christian denominations, the organization is actively seeking involvement from other faith groups.
